区块链UTC 8 是一个技术性的话题,它涉及到区块
### 区块链是什么?
在深入探讨“区块链UTC 8”之前,我们首先要理解什么是区块链。区块链是一种去中心化的分布式账本技术,能够安全、透明地记录交易、合同、资产转移和其他相关信息。每一个区块包含了一定数量的交易记录,并通过密码学技术与前一个区块链接,形成一个“链”,因而得名“区块链”。
区块链的核心优势在于其去中心化、防篡改和透明性。这使得它在金融、供应链管理、身份认证、电子投票等多个领域得到了广泛应用。为了确保所有参与者对交易的时间和状态有共同的理解,区块链网络需要有效的时间管理系统,而这正是我们接下来要讨论的关键。
### 什么是UTC?
“UTC”是“协调世界时”(Universal Coordinated Time)的缩写,它是一种国际标准时间,不依赖于任何特定的时区。UTC是全球统一的时间基准,广泛应用于科学、航空、航海和信息技术等领域。UTC时间不会因夏令时而变化,它一直保持不变,确保在全球范围内的时间一致性。
由于每个国家和地区有自己的标准时间,与UTC的差异就形成了不同的时区。例如,北京时间是UTC 8,即在UTC的基础上增加8小时。因此,各种与时间密切相关的应用在区块链领域中,也需要考虑这些时区的调整。
### 区块链UTC 8是什么意思?
在区块链的背景下,“UTC 8”通常是指对于每一笔交易或事件,使用北京(或其他UTC 8时区)作为时间标准。这意味着所有记录在区块链上的时间戳都将执行相应的时区调整,确保不同地区的用户可以在本地时间下理解交易状态。
对于使用区块链技术的开发者和用户来说,区块链UTC 8 的意义主要体现在以下几个方面:
1. **时间戳的准确性**:使用UTC 8作为时间标准,可以减少时间差异带来的混淆,确保交易记录的时间准确无误。
2. **统一性**:区块链网络是全球性的,而UTC 8的使用则能为来自不同地区的参与者提供统一的时间基准。这对于处理跨国交易和合同执行尤为重要。
3. **透明性**:记录在区块链上的交易时间是透明的,任何人都可以验证;而使用UTC 8的时间戳,可以减少因地方时间差异而造成的争议。
4. **合规性**:许多国家和地区在进行金融交易时,都有相关的法律要求,这些法律中可能涉及到时间的标准化。因此,采用UTC 8有助于满足当地的法律法规。
5. **开发效率**:在区块链应用开发中,由于时间戳的标准化,开发者可以更高效地构建和维护系统,减少因时间差异导致的错误。
### 为什么区块链需要时间戳?
区块链的核心之一就是其不可篡改性,这就要求每笔交易必须具备可靠的时间记录。在数字货币交易中,交易时间的准确性至关重要,一旦发生争议,时间戳往往是解决问题的关键证据。此外,时间戳还可以在智能合约中发挥重要作用,确保合同在特定时间段内执行。
### 可能相关的问题
接下来,我们将探讨与“区块链UTC 8”相关的五个问题,并对每一个问题进行详细分析。
#### 1. 如何在区块链上生成时间戳?
在区块链上生成时间戳的过程通常涉及到区块链网络的共识机制。区块链网络通过多个节点共同验证每一笔交易,并为其生成一个时间戳。这些时间戳一般记录在区块头部,并随区块一起被加入链中,以提高其不可篡改性和透明性。
时间戳的生成通常是自动化的,开发者在设计区块链应用时,可以通过调用相关的API或函数,直接将UTC时间记录到交易中。而为了适应不同用户的需求,用户也可以在交易发起时手动设置其时间戳。
需要注意的是,区块链上的时间戳在不同的共识机制中表现不同。例如,在比特币网络中,时间戳由矿工在打包区块时自行设置,但并不意味着这一时间是完全不可变的,因为矿工的时间设置可能会出现偏差。因此,区块链开发者需要确保时间的准确性,以减少争议和错误。
#### 2. 区块链时间戳与传统时间戳有何不同?
区块链的时间戳与传统的时间戳有几个显著的区别:
- **去中心化**:传统的时间戳通常依赖于中心化的服务器,如NTP(网络时间协议)服务器。这意味着如果这些服务器出现故障,所有依赖其时间的系统也会受到影响。而区块链的时间戳则是去中心化的,由多个节点共同维护,极大保障了时间的真实性与准确性。
- **不可篡改性**:区块链上的时间戳一旦被记录,便无法被更改。传统的时间戳系统可能因为人为或技术原因被篡改,从而导致信息失真。这是区块链的一大优势。
- **选择性**:在传统的系统中,时间的记载往往是不容选择的,但是在区块链中,开发者可以选择使用UTC或其他时区的时间,可以基于应用需求进行设定。
- **验证和审计**:区块链时间戳是公开的,任何人都可以验证每一笔记录的时间。而在传统的系统中,时间戳通常是封闭的,只有授权用户才能访问。
因此,区块链的时间戳具有更强的安全性和公信力,适合用于金融、法律等需要时间证据的场合。
#### 3. 时区对区块链应用的影响是什么?
时区对于区块链应用的影响是非常直接而广泛的。在全球化的今天,许多区块链项目都旨在服务跨国用户,而各个国家存在的时区差异使得时间的处理变得复杂,影响了交易的执行和法律合规性。
- **交易时间的分歧**:不同的用户可能在不同的本地时间进行交易,这使得交易顺序、操作时机等必须进行同步。而采用UTC时间作为行业标准,可以大大简化这一流程。
- **法律合规性**:某些灵活的法律条款会根据交易发生的时间区间进行设定,因此包含时区信息的时间戳是合规的重要参考。
- **用户体验**:如果不同地区的用户不能快速理解其交易时间,有可能导致用户混淆,使其放弃使用该平台。因此,清晰的时间标志对于用户友好性至关重要。
综上所述,时区不仅影响区块链的交易质量,还关系到法律要求以及用户体验。开发者在设计区块链产品时,需认真对待这个问题。
#### 4. 区块链交易的时间延迟如何影响用户?
在区块链交易中,时间延迟的影响可通过几个方面表现出来:
- **交易确认时间**:每笔交易都有一定的确认时间,这个时间长短直接关系到交易的完成。如果延误,用户将无法及时掌握自已资产的状态,影响其后续操作。
- **市场波动**:数字货币市场波动极快,如果交易未能在用户期望的时间被确认,可能会导致损失。例如,用户希望在价格下跌之前出售资产,但由于确认延迟,交易未能按时完成。
- **用户信任**:持续的时间延迟,也可能导致用户对平台的信任下降,影响用户的忠诚度。因此,区块链开发者和运营方需加强网络性能,以减少时间延迟的影响。
解决时间延迟问题的方法包括网络算法、增加节点、增强链下解决方案等。尽量减少延迟可以提高用户满意度,助于区块链技术更好地发展。
#### 5. 区块链未来的发展中时区的作用会如何变化?
在未来的区块链发展中,时区的作用将可能呈现出以下几种趋势:
- **全球化标准**:随着区块链被越来越多的企业和个人接受,可能会朝着更加全球化的标准方向发展。在这种情况下,UTC可能会成为更加普遍应用的时间标准,取而代之的是对本地时间的依赖。
- **智能合约的普及**:未来的区块链应用中,智能合约将更加普及,这些合约可能会利用设定的时间戳来动作,从而引导合约执行的准确性。因此,时间的标准化将变得至关重要。
- **用户友好的解决方案**:由于用户需求在不断变化,未来的区块链发展将更加关注用户体验,因此涉及到的时间展示将做到更为人性化,以适应不同用户的习惯。
- **法律合规性将成为核心**:随着区块链在金融领域的深入应用,相关的法律法规日益增加,这使得合规性成为企业的重要任务。各种地区的法律合规性将直接推动对时间和时区的标准化。
总结来看,区块链中的“UTC 8”不仅是简单的时间标记,更是影响整个生态系统的重要因素。通过深入了解区块链技术与时间管理的关系,可以帮助用户更好地理解和参与这一革命性的技术变化。